The Waterside is the latest venture by The La Colombe Group, located on Pierhead at the V&A Waterfront. Headed by Roxy Mudie, serving both a reduced menu and tasting menu. Inside and outside seating is available

Gourmet Guide™ Description

Small and intimate, with striking views, Waterside in the Pierhead Building lives up to its name, with every seat embracing harbour views. It’s a special treat, rather than a special occasion. Summer allows for dining on the deck, where the background bustle adds to the appeal
for local and international diners.

Head chef Roxanne Mudie’s flavour profiles can be coined “East Meets East,” or daring meets well executed. Her inspiration is deeply rooted in her passion for Asian cuisine, which she has cleverly integrated into a single menu that is as creative as it is brave. From the first bite of bread, you’ll be entranced. The menu boasts standout dishes like Asian pork belly with scallops, corn, peanuts, and Szechuan, artfully plated. The crayfish dumpling with pickled kohlrabi and dashi broth is a winner.

The presentation is impeccable, where each dish is a testament to meticulous attention to detail. The impressive wine list showcases mainly South African selections, with a choice of a standard or iconic pairing. Confident staff navigate the tables with ease. The team, led by manager Van Zyl Van der Merwe, is knowledgeable, display a real sense of ownership, and their energy is infectious. Here high expectations are exceeded.
